    The Men’s Wellbeing Network (MWN) group is designed to support improved experience and to promote equality within the workplace with a focus on gender issues impacting men’s wellbeing at work - a safe space for men and those who identify as men to share experiences and talk about issues around their mental wellbeing.

    The stereotype that men have to be strong macho types, affected by nothing, and the protectors of their families, has perpetuated a culture of reluctance to express any concerns for their own mental wellbeing, a refusal to ask for help and, a reticence to engage with health services. The attitude, perception, or belief that any ‘imperfection’ is a sign of weakness is a cause for concern.
